Leamer Surname Meaning

Americanized form of German Lehmer.

Source: Dictionary of American Family Names 2nd edition, 2022

Where is the Leamer family from?

You can see how Leamer families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Leamer family name was found in the USA, the UK, Canada, and Scotland between 1840 and 1920. The most Leamer families were found in United Kingdom in 1891. In 1891 there were 30 Leamer families living in London. This was about 16% of all the recorded Leamer's in United Kingdom. London had the highest population of Leamer families in 1891.

What is the average Leamer lifespan?

Between 1943 and 2004, in the United States, Leamer life expectancy was at its lowest point in 1943, and highest in 1994. The average life expectancy for Leamer in 1943 was 41, and 69 in 2004.
